Q: Is 341,645,656 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 341,645,656 is not a prime number.

Why is 341,645,656 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 341645656 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 11 22 44 88 491 982 1,964 3,928 5,401 7,907 10,802 15,814 21,604 31,628 43,208 63,256 86,977 173,954 347,908 695,816 3,882,337 7,764,674 15,529,348 31,058,696 42,705,707 85,411,414 170,822,828 and 341,645,656, with no remainder.

Since 341,645,656 cannot be divided by just 1 and 341,645,656, it is not a prime number.
